This card layout is very simple and it could easily be used for other clean and simple cards! Just simply change up the sentiment and the color of paper and BAM – a whole new card! True I have used a bunch of paper today and if you follow my blog you already know that I adore paper!

To me, paper can do so much and be so effective in making a clean and simple card! Remember to utilize the paper that you are covering with another layer! This is a perfect time to use your punched…framelits etc…to use for future cards!

Here are the measurements for all of the layers that are going on today! I know that you enjoy it when I give you the measurements!

  • The base is a good old A-2 card and the black layer is just 1/4 smaller – 5 1/4" X 4" (remember cut the black piece as it will be covered up) and add the next layer in whisper white which is  1/4" smaller 5" X 3 3/4"

  • The Tangerine Tango is 3 1/2 X 4 3/4" and then the Designer Series Paper from the Motley Monster DSP and it is 3 3/8" X 4 5/8"…. Take this piece to your Big Shot and Place the #4 square framelit and cut the square out!

TIP – do not adhere it yet…I like to take it over top of the base piece and take a pencil to draw a line where the square is and then stamp it…So much easier!

  • Erase your pencil lines and now you can adhere it to the base. (I was going to put stampin' dimensionals under the orange piece but I decided against it and I really like the look!
  • I made the back square border with framefilt #4 & #5 as I thought this element would add a great contast and a quick dash of dots did the trick!
  • Last but not least…the envelope! I had some fun as I lined the outer flap and then while I had my big shot and sentiment all "onky" – I decided to jazz up the back!

TIP – I have shared this with you before and I will say that I do ask the people that I send cards to if they can through the mail o.k. – like this card…take it to the counter of the post office and ask them to "hand stamp" it….this way it will not go through the machine and I find that using the tombow liquid glue is the best!!!
